INDIAN WELLS, Calif. — Newly minted Australian Open champion Madison Keys crushed Anastasia Potapova 6-3, 6-0 at Indian Wells on Saturday in her first match as a Grand Slam champion.
Keys broke Russian Potapova’s serve for a 3rd time to clinch the primary set and rolled by way of the one-sided second set beneath sunny skies within the California desert to increase her successful streak to 13 matches.

Subsequent up for world No. 5 Keys is a third-round assembly with No. 28 seed Elise Mertens, who beat Kimberly Birrell of Australia 6-4, 7-5 later Saturday.
Additionally Saturday, high seed Aryna Sabalenka was examined however in the end prevailed over younger American McCartney Kessler 7-6 (4), 6-3.
The Belarusian was in full command of her formidable serve and by no means confronted a break level whereas crushing six aces and successful 90% of her first-serve factors.
She sealed the win with a pair of deft backhand volleys on match level to arrange a gathering with Italian Lucia Bronzetti.
